Comprehending UPVC Door Glass Types
Before going over the replacement process, it's vital to understand the various types of glass used in UPVC doors. Here's a streamlined breakdown:
Type of GlassFunctionsBest ForDouble GlazingMuch better insulation, lowered noise levelsHouses in loud locations, energy savingsTriple GlazingSuperior insulation, outstanding sound reductionExtreme climates, energy-saving homesTempered GlassShatterproof glass that's more resistant to injuryHigh-traffic locations, homes with kidsLaminated GlassDecreases UV rays, reinforces securityLocations needing added security, UV securityObscure GlassProvides personal privacy while allowing light inRestrooms, private spacesReasons for UPVC Door Glass Replacement
There can be many reasons that a homeowner might want or require to replace the glass in their UPVC doors, consisting of:
Cracks and Chips: Over time, glass can end up being chipped or broke due to impacts.Foggy Appearance: This can suggest seal failure in double or triple glazing.Upgrading Efficiency: High-quality glass can enhance thermal efficiency.Visual Needs: A desire for newer designs or patterns might demand a glass swap.Security Reasons: Enhanced security functions might be preferred for security improvements.The Glass Replacement Process
Replacing the glass in a UPVC door can seem difficult, but with the right tools and understanding, it can be achieved efficiently. Here's a detailed guide to the replacement procedure:
Step 1: Gather Necessary Tools and Materials
Before starting, ensure you have the following tools and products:
Tools/MaterialsDescriptionScrewdriverFor getting rid of screws from the door frameGlass cutterTo cut glass to size, if necessarySafety glassesProtects the eyes during the processGlazing beadsHolds the glass in locationShimsImproves insulation and fits securelyReplacement glassNew glass matched for UPVC doorsSilicone sealantSeals around the glass to avoid leaksStep 2: Remove the Old GlassSafety First: Wear shatterproof glass to protect your eyes from fragments.Remove Glazing Beads: Carefully get rid of the beads surrounding the glass. These might require a little spying.Take Out the Glass: Gently raise out the broken or foggy glass. It's advisable to have somebody help you during this process to prevent any injury.Action 3: Prepare the New GlassCut New Glass: If you need to cut brand-new glass, use a glass cutter to score it and then snap it off.Apply Silicone Sealant: Surround the frame with a thin line of silicone sealant.Step 4: Install New GlassPosition the New Glass: Carefully position the brand-new glass into the frame.Place Glazing Beads: Fix the beads back around the glass, ensuring they securely hold the glass in place.Seal Edges with Silicone: For an additional seal, use silicone around the edges.Step 5: Test the Seal
Inspect for leakages and ensure the glass is protected in place. If you observe any gaps, re-apply silicone sealant.
Maintenance Tips
To prolong the life of your UPVC door glass and maintain its appearance, consider the following maintenance 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the glass using non-abrasive cleaners to avoid scratching.Check Seals: Regularly check seals for wear or gaps that may require resealing.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Steer clear of utilizing extreme chemicals that can deteriorate UPVC material.Check Locks and Hinges: Regularly keep locks and hinges, ensuring they operate efficiently.FAQs1. Just how much does UPVC door glass replacement cost?
The cost will differ depending on the kind of glass and labor included. On average, you may expect to pay between ₤ 150 to ₤ 400.
2. Can I change the glass myself?
Yes, with the right tools and following the appropriate actions, many homeowners can effectively replace the glass on their own. Nevertheless, if you're not sure, it may be best to work with a professional.
3. How long does the replacement process take?
Usually, if doing it yourself, it can take in between 1 to 3 hours, depending upon your experience level.
4. How do I understand if my UPVC door requires a glass replacement?
Indications consist of noticeable fractures, condensation between the glass panes, and increased energy costs due to poor insulation.
5. Is it necessary to hire a professional for glass replacement?
If you feel unpredictable about performing the replacement securely or efficiently, working with a professional will guarantee the job is done correctly and safely.
